Peaceful Reunification Called for in S. Korea

Pyongyang, October 6 (KCNA) -- A festival for peaceful reunification marking the fourth anniversary of the October 4 declaration took place in south Korea on Oct. 4.

Present there were members of the South Side Committee for Implementing the June 15 Joint Declaration and the steering committee of the festival for peaceful reunification, personages of opposition parties and Inchon citizens.

An appeal by All-Korean Committee for Implementation of June 15 Joint Declaration on the fourth anniversary of the October 4 declaration was read out there.

Then speeches were made.

Speakers denounced the authorities for finally making abortive the national joint event to mark the fourth anniversary of the October 4 declaration.

People from all walks of life in south Korea who had been filled with hope for reunification after the publication of the June 15 joint declaration and the October 4 declaration are suffering from a nightmare since the emergence of the present "government," they said, and went on:

No one can deny the significance of the south-north joint declarations in the national history.

The south and north of Korea should pool their efforts to put an end to the misfortune of the homogeneous nation being forced to live in separation in one and the same land.

They called for achieving peaceful reunification by thoroughly implementing the joint declarations.

Messages of solidarity from the North Side Committee and Overseas Side Committee for Implementing the June 15 Joint Declaration were introduced at the festival.
